Extraparenchymal neurocysticercosis (EP-NC) is a chronic, potentially life-threatening disease that responds poorly to initial anthelmintic drug therapy. A depressed specific reactivity of peripheral lymphocytes and an increased level Tregs accompanies EP-NC. The immune checkpoint pathway PD-1 its ligand PD-L1 downregulates effector T cells, causing suppression in chronic diseases.
